数据标准化和数据归一化有啥区别吗?

Posted

tags:

篇首语:本文由小常识网(cha138.com)小编为大家整理,主要介绍了数据标准化和数据归一化有啥区别吗?相关的知识,希望对你有一定的参考价值。

归一化,就是为了限定你的输入向量的最大值跟最小值不超过你的隐层跟输出层函数的限定范围。比如,你的隐层的传递函数为logsig,那么你的输出就在0~1范围内,如果你的传递函数为tansig,你的隐层的输出在-1~·范围内,用归一化,这也是为了你的隐层传递函数的输出着想。
标准化,只是对数据进行了统一的标准,其大小可能已经超出了隐层传递函数的界定范围,在后续的运行时,容易出错。
参考技术A 当然是EXCEL简单,你看看有多少人用 EXCEL就知道了,但是有几个人知道SPSS是个统计软件呢?

我不知道你说的标准化处理是什么意思,但是无量纲化处理指的是,对于一个数列n,如果一致该数列的绝对值存在极限|N|,那么将该数列中每个元素除以这个极限值n/|N|,得到的是一个正负百分比序列n%,所有取值都在正负1范围内,这种叫做无量纲化处理,好处是可以将一些基数过大或者过小的序列按照一个统一的标准进行比较,看起来很方便。

比如说,你说美国人很有钱,一个美国人每年挣10万美金,一个中国人很穷,一年挣2万人民币,但是如果把房价作为一个基准,那么可以认为,一个美国人一年工资可以买到30平米房子,一个中国人也许一年工资也就是买1平米房子,这就是无量纲化处理的方法,两者从不可比到同一一个基准的方法

但愿你能看懂
参考技术B 当然是EXCEL简单,你看看有多少人用 EXCEL就知道了,但是有几个人知道SPSS是个统计软件呢?

我不知道你说的标准化处理是什么意思,但是无量纲化处理指的是,对于一个数列n,如果一致该数列的绝对值存在极限|N|,那么将该数列中每个元素除以这个极限值n/|N|,得到的是一个正负百分比序列n%,所有取值都在正负1范围内,这种叫做无量纲化处理,好处是可以将一些基数过大或者过小的序列按照一个统一的标准进行比较,看起来很方便。

比如说,你说美国人很有钱,一个美国人每年挣10万美金,一个中国人很穷,一年挣2万人民币,但是如果把房价作为一个基准,那么可以认为,一个美国人一年工资可以买到30平米房子,一个中国人也许一年工资也就是买1平米房子,这就是无量纲化处理的方法,两者从不可比到同一一个基准的方法

但愿你能看懂

以上是关于数据标准化和数据归一化有啥区别吗?的主要内容,如果未能解决你的问题,请参考以下文章

中心化、标准化、归一化?

数据标准化、归一化、正则化概念厘定

2.1对 特征归一化 的一些理解

spss实现中心化处理、标准化处理和归一化处理

数据变换-归一化与标准化

Python 数据归一化/标准化